The sliding blocks are fixedly connected to the front wall and the rear wall of the moving plate, sliding grooves are vertically formed in the front wall and the rear wall of the cavity, and the sliding blocks extend into the sliding grooves and are in sliding connection with the sliding grooves.
And a limiting block is fixedly connected to the bottom end of the screw rod.
The driving mechanism comprises a first driving wheel fixedly sleeved on the upper part outside the screw rod, a motor groove is formed in the middle of the inner top wall of the cavity, a second motor is fixedly arranged in the motor groove, a second driving wheel is fixedly sleeved on the outer part of an output shaft of the second motor, and the second driving wheel is in driving connection with the first driving wheels on two sides through chains.
The cross section of the filter screen is smaller than that of the filter tank body, and a clamping structure is formed between the filter screen and the filter tank body.
The scraping structure comprises a connecting block, the connecting block is arranged on two sides of the bottom end of the filter screen, the connecting rods are arranged on the bottom end of the connecting block, annular scraping strips are arranged on the bottom end of the connecting rod, the cross section of each annular scraping strip is smaller than that of the filter tank body, the annular scraping strips are attached to the inner side wall of the filter tank body, the connecting rods are arranged in two groups, and the connecting rods are symmetrically distributed with respect to the central axis of the filter screen.
The disassembly and assembly structure comprises a fixed block fixedly arranged on the bottom wall of the cover body, a fixed groove is formed in the bottom wall of the fixed block, one end of a fixed rod is inserted into the fixed groove, the other end of the fixed rod extends to the outside of the fixed groove and is fixedly connected with the inner bottom wall of the filter screen, a hollow body is fixedly arranged on the outer wall of one side of the fixed block, a limiting plate is movably arranged in the hollow body, a slot is formed in the upper side of one side of the fixed rod, an inserting block is fixedly connected on one side of the limiting plate, the inserting block penetrates through the hollow body and the side wall and is inserted into the slot, a movable rod is fixedly connected on the other side of the limiting plate, and one end of the movable rod penetrates out of the hollow body and is fixedly connected with a pulling plate.

As shown in fig. 1 and 2, the filter for preventing volatile of essential oil according to the present utility model further includes: the novel automatic feeding device is characterized in that a moving mechanism 3 is arranged in the cavity 2, the moving mechanism 3 comprises a moving plate 3.1 movably arranged in the cavity 2, universal wheels 3.2 are rotatably arranged at four corners of the bottom wall of the moving plate 3.1, screw rods 3.3 are rotatably connected to two sides of the inner top wall of the cavity 2, screw sleeves 3.4 are sleeved outside the screw rods 3.3 and fixedly connected with two side walls of the moving plate 3.1 respectively, a driving mechanism 4 for driving the screw rods 3.3 to rotate is arranged in the cavity 2, the driving mechanism 4 comprises a first driving wheel 4.1 fixedly sleeved above the outer side of the screw rods 3.3, a motor groove is formed in the middle of the inner top wall of the cavity 2, a second motor 4.2 is fixedly arranged in the motor groove, a second driving wheel 4.3 is fixedly sleeved outside an output shaft of the second motor 4.2, and the second driving wheel 4.3 is in transmission connection with the first driving wheels 4.1 on two sides through a chain 4.4.
In this embodiment, as shown in fig. 1, the second motor 4.2 is started to rotate forward so that the second driving wheel 4.3 rotates, the second driving wheel 4.3 drives the first driving wheel 4.1 to rotate through the chain 4.4, the first driving wheel 4.1 rotates so that the screw rod 3.3 rotates, the screw sleeve 3.4 drives the moving plate 3.1 to move downwards, the moving plate 3.1 drives the universal wheel 3.2 to move downwards until the universal wheel moves out of the base 1 and the device is supported up, the device can be moved until the universal wheel moves to a proper position, and after the universal wheel moves to a proper position, the second motor 4.2 is started to rotate reversely so that the universal wheel 3.2 is retracted into the base 1, so that the stability of the device in use can be improved, and meanwhile, the service life of the universal wheel 3.2 can also be improved.
